The following excerpt is from People v. Cruz, 38 Cal.App.4th 427, 45 Cal.Rptr.2d 148 (Cal. App. 1995):
"Section 654 when applicable precludes punishment 'under' more than one criminal provision. It has long been established that the imposition of concurrent sentences is precluded by section 654 because the defendant is deemed to be subjected to the term of both sentences although they are served simultaneously." (People v. Miller (1977) 18 Cal.3d 873, 887, 135 Cal.Rptr. 654, 558 P.2d 552. Citations omitted. Italics in original.)
